This kind of shower controls are the best. I had this on my shower but right now my place is gutted for a remodel. I really want to get the same exact kind that you have. It’s super convenient because you set the temperature once and then adjust the pressure separately. You don’t have to constantly tune it to the right temperature with every shower.

Oh dude, this is my time to shine, please listen to my story. I bought my volcano about 18 years ago after watching this really stupid TV show that had a segment about the best way to get stoned. They said something like joints get you 25-35% of the THC, bongs are 55-65%, vaporizers are 85-95%. I said shit, I’m not giving up smoking weed any time soon so I might as well invest in my future. I bought it for like $450 at a sketchy open market in LA. I parked the Porsche I was driving behind a bunch of men in cowboy clothes drinking beer on their pickup truck in the middle of the day. Everyone was super nice and my car still had all 4 wheels when I returned.
The Volcano is fucking great. You can see how strong your dose is going to be, there’s no smoke, it cools down in the bag, it never irritates my throat, and when smoking with people everyone gets to hit fresh greens from the bag. The thing is built by the Germans so it’s a fucking tank, and not the kind that freeze up in the Russian winter. In the 18 years I’ve had it, the only thing that broke is the air switch that was easily and cheaply replaced and one screw rattled out and disappeared.
As for efficiency, I bought a large ziplock bag full of weed in February of 2018. After sharing a lot with friends, I finally ran out like 2 months ago. For those too stoned to do the math, my volcano made my bag of weed last for over 5 fucking years. I would easily make 1 bowl last about a week before packing a new one, smoking once every day.
I can’t recommend the Volcano enough. The only downside is that it’s not portable and you have to wait 6 minutes for it to heat up, but that’s never been an issue. I bought the Crafty from Storz & Bickel too and it’s really great for a portable device. Please take my advice. Save up the money and get yourself a Volcano, you won’t regret it!

I remember reading the opposite back in the day, that this is why RMS dislikes the term “open source” and prefers “Free software” as more descriptive. Open source refers to software where you can read the source, but the license it’s under does not necessarily gaurantee freedom to the user.
